  • Patent number: 7638457
    Abstract: Disclosed is a process for the preparation of a modified vanadium/phosphorus mixed oxide catalyst for the partial oxidation of n-butane to maleic anhydride. The catalyst comprises vanadyl pyrophosphate as main component and niobium as a promoter element in an amount corresponding to an atomic ratio of vanadium to niobiurn in the range of 250:1 to 60:1. The catalyst exhibits improved activity, improved yield of maleic anhydride, and optimal performance from the very beginning of its catalytic lifetime.

  • Patent number: 7619099
    Abstract: An improved process for the production of maleic anhydride by the catalytic oxidation of n-butane. Maleic anhydride is produced by reacting n-butane gas with oxygen gas or an oxygen-containing gas, in the presence of a vanadium phosphorus oxide catalyst. A trialkyl phosphite or trialkyl phosphate component is continuously added to the gases in an amount of from about 0.5 ppm to about 4 ppm by weight of elemental phosphorus in the trialkyl phosphate or trialkyl phosphite component. Heat is applied to the gases at a temperature of from about 400° C. to about 440° C. while maintaining a maximum temperature of gases present in the reaction of about 480° C. A simultaneous conversion of n-butane to maleic anhydride of about 84% or more and a conversion of n-butane to by-product acrylic acid of about 1.5% or less is achieved.

  • Patent number: 7557223
    Abstract: Catalytic compositions of oxides of titanium, vanadium and tin that are suitable for the production of phthalic anhydride by oxidizing o-xylene and/or naphthalene in the gas phase. The catalysts exhibit excellent activity and selectivity. The catalyst contains 2 to 15 percent by weight (calculated as V2O5) of vanadium, 1 to 15 percent weight (calculated as SnO2) of tin and 70 to 97 percent by weight (calculated as TiO2) of titanium. In a preferred embodiment the catalyst also contains up to 5 percent by weight (calculated as M2O) of at least one alkali metal, preferably lithium, potassium or rubidium, and more preferably cesium. In an even more preferred embodiment, cesium is present in an amount of from 0.01 to 2 percent by weight (calculated as Cs2O).

  • Patent number: 6956004
    Abstract: Active vanadium/phosphorus mixed oxide catalyst for the conversion of non-aromatic hydrocarbons, e.g., n-butane, into maleic anhydride. The catalyst is prepared from the catalyst precursor, that is, prepared by the reaction of a source of vanadium in an organic medium in the presence of a phosphorus source. The organic medium is (a) isobutyl alcohol or a mixture of isobutyl alcohol and benzyl alcohol and (b) a polyol. The catalyst precurso is transformed into the active catalyst by an activation process that includes a heat treatment that includes applying a temperature of up to 600° C.

  • Patent number: 6858561
    Abstract: A process for preparing a catalyst for maleic anhydride production wherein a +5 vanadium compound such as V2O5, an anhydrous phosphoric acid, and optionally promoters are admixed in an organic alcohol solvent, the admixture is rapidly brought to reflux and thereafter refluxed to reduced the vanadium compound to the desired degree, the reflux mixture is cooled, precursor crystals are separated by filtration and then dried and calcined.

  • Patent number: 6734135
    Abstract: A process for the preparation of a vanadium/phosphorus mixed oxide catalyst precursor is described, comprising the reaction of a vanadium source in selected organic media in the presence of a phophorus source. The medium comprises: (a) isobutyl alcohol or a mixture of isobutyl alcohol and benzyl alcohol and (b) a polyol in the weight ratio (a) to (b) of 99:1 to 5:95. After its activation, the vanadium/phosphorus mixed oxide catalyst precursor is an excellent catalyst in the conversion of non-aromatic hydrocarbons like n-butane to malic anhydride.

  • Patent number: 5847163
    Abstract: A vanadium/phosphorus mixed oxide catalyst precursor is transformed into the active catalyst for the production of maleic anhydride. The activation takes place in a fluidized bed and includes the steps of (a) initially heating the precursor; (b) further heating under superatmospheric pressure; (c) isothermal stage at superatmospheric pressure; and, finally, (d) cooling the activated catalyst obtained. Catalysts activated according to this procedure show high performance in the conversion of non-aromatic hydrocarbons to maleic anhydride.
